【推荐1】如图所示,Rt△ABC中:∠C=90°,AB=6,在AB上取点O,以O为圆心,以OB为半径作圆,与AC相切于点D,并分别与AB,BC相交于点E,F(异于点B).
(1)求证:BD平分∠ABC;
(2)若点E恰好是AO的中点,求弧BF的长;
(3)若CF的长为1,求⊙O的半径长.
